导航:首页 > 编程语言 > python斗地主真实案例

python斗地主真实案例

发布时间:2023-03-04 17:21:08

‘壹’ 用python能制作游戏吗

能,但不适合。
用锤子能造汽车吗? 谁也没法说不能吧?历史上也确实曾经有些汽车,是用锤子造出来的。但一般来说,还是用工业机器人更合适对吗?
比较大型的,使用Python的游戏有两个,一个是《EVE》,还有一个是《文明》。但这仅仅是个例,没有广泛意义。
一般来说,用来做游戏的语言,有两种。一是C++。。一是C#。。
Python理论上,不仅不适合做游戏,而是只要大型的程序,都不适合。只适合写比较小型的东西,比如一个计算器,一个爬虫等。
主要有2个方面,一是速度慢,二是语法缺陷。
也许你一定觉得,Python的语法又干净,又优雅,怎么还有缺陷?但仔细想想,为什么别的语言没有这么干净?没有这么优雅?明明可以直接a=123 干嘛非要写成 int a=123;呢?难道是其他语言的设计者,都有强迫症吗?道理很简单,有得必有失。
如果数据类型,只有字符串和数字,省略掉声明变量的过程,当然不是问题。但只要逻辑一复杂,情况就完全不同了。。。游戏中,你用C#或C++写起来,大概会是这样。
技能 a=xxxx;
武器 b=xxxx;
角色 c=xxxx;
药水 d=xxxx;
音乐 e=xxxx;
而Python呢?大概是这个样子
a=xxxx
b=xxxx
c=xxxx
d=xxxx
如果你的代码很少,显然是Python比较方便。但如果你创建几百个对象,代码超过1万行。。。写到几千行的时候,遇到一个叫x的对象,你还知道它到底是个啥吗?是一把武器?还是一瓶药水?还是一张图片?一段音频?一盏灯光?一座房子?
不要以为1万行代码很多。。。。1万行连个《斗地主》都写不完。。
用Python写大程序的感觉就是,当你第一天,只写了50行代码,创建了3个类,5个对象。你会觉得太爽了,这绝对是世界上最好的语言。。。第二天,你又创建了2个类,5个对象的时候,就觉得有点晕晕的了。第三天,又创建了2个类之后,你会发现自己必须非常仔细的看一遍注释,否则就不会写了。第四天,你一整天都在看注释。。。。
这就是动态语言的劣根性。一开始代码量少,看不出任何缺点,各种省事,各种爽。代码量越多,脑子越乱。一般500行以上,效率就会被JAVA,C#之类的语言反超。。1000行,就必须要各种加注释才能看懂了。。2000行,注释比代码还多了。。5000行,注释已经完全不管用了,自己根本看不懂自己的代码,需要准备弃坑了。

‘贰’ 快手平台说玩斗地主能赚钱是真的吗

玩游戏能赚钱、看视频能赚钱、

猜成语能赚钱、走路能赚钱、

甚至睡觉也能赚钱

......

你见过这种“赚钱”类APP的广告吗?

图片

近日

深圳市市场监管局

结合实际案例

发布“赚钱”类APP消费警示↓

1

“馅饼”还是“陷阱”?

近日,深圳市市场监管局收到消费者李某对“全民开餐厅”APP的投诉,该APP宣称不需要邀请好友就能赚钱,提现没有门槛。李某称:“结果还是要邀请好友才能提现所有金额,不然就只能提现0.3元。”

图片

2

“赚钱”类APP这样“套路”你

李某的情况并非个例。深圳市市场监管局表示,先用“能赚钱”吸引消费者使用APP,使用过程中,消费者会不断被诱导观看广告。

APP运营商依靠达成“目标”后高额的提现来欺骗消费者观看推送的广告,通过卖广告获利。

为了“拖住”消费者,一开始,这些APP会给出几十元的奖励,营造一种很快就能提现的错觉。之后即使难度增加,消费者也会因不想放弃现有的奖励,继续玩下去,看越来越多的广告。

图片

满0.3元即可提现实际上只能提现0.3元

消费者花了大量时间完成“赚钱”类APP设定的目标后,真的可以提现几十元甚至上百元?

事实上也不行。在达到“赚钱”类APP所设定的“等级”“步数”等目标后,紧接而来的可能会是让消费者满足“登录条件”,满足后可能会再让消费者“邀请好友”,以此类推,层层加码。

当消费者幡然醒悟时,也已经晚了。闲暇时间用来看广告,自己的个人信息在注册时给了运营商,甚至存在个人信息被买卖的风险。

所以,这些“赚钱”类APP并不是来帮消费者赚钱的,反之,消费者才是他们赚钱的工具。

图片

3

警示

“馅饼”里可能包着“陷阱”

根据深圳市市场监管局2021年下半年广告监测数据显示,“网赚”类广告在下半年监测到的所有广告中占比13.8%,这些广告中广告宣传用语涉嫌违规的占比高达62.3%。

深圳市市场监管局提醒消费者:

遇上“好事”先冷静,不被诱惑做决定,“馅饼”里往往包着“陷阱”。如发现此类违法广告,可拨打12315或12345举报。

最后,也提醒这类APP的运营商与广告主,此类广告涉嫌违反《广告法》第三条、第四条、第二十八条的规定,一旦认定违法,市场监管部门会依据《广告法》第五十五条进行处罚;情节严重的,依据《刑法》第二百二十二条,可以处2年以下有期徒刑或者拘役

‘叁’ 斗地主的详细规则是什么大神们帮帮忙

1.发牌 3人玩,一副牌54张,一人17张,留3张做底牌,在确定地主之前玩家不能看底牌(3张底牌在屏幕正上方扣着显示)。确定地主后,底牌亮出,显示在屏幕正上方。 2. 叫牌 叫牌按出牌的顺序轮流开始,每人只能叫一次。叫牌时可以叫“1分”, “2分”,“3分”,“不叫”。后叫牌者只能叫比前面玩家高的分或者不叫。叫牌结束后所叫分值最大的玩家为地主;如果有玩家叫“3分”则立即结束叫牌,该玩家为地主;如果都不叫,则重新发牌,重新叫牌。 第一个叫牌的玩家 第一轮叫牌的玩家由系统选定,以后每一轮首先叫牌的玩家按出牌顺序轮流担任。 3.出牌 将三张底牌交给地主,并亮出底牌让所有人都能看到。地主首先出牌,然后按逆时针顺序依次出牌,轮到用户跟牌时,用户可以选择“不出”或出比上一个玩家大的牌。“提示”可以根据规则选出可以出的牌,某一玩家出完牌时结束本局。 4.亮牌 抢得地主的玩家在拿到底牌后如果有信心取胜,在出牌前可以点击“亮牌”按钮,将自己的牌摊开来打,亮牌后地主和两农民的得失分乘3倍。 加棒 当有人叫3分抢得地主后,两农民中如果有人对自己一方取胜有信心,可以选择“加棒”地主,加棒后该农民与地主之间的得失分翻倍。 胜负判定 任意一家出完牌后结束游戏,若是地主先出完牌则地主胜,否则另外两家胜

‘肆’ python能做什么游戏

Python是一门高级且有趣的编程语言,除了网络爬虫、人工智能、数据分析之外,Python还可以进行游戏开发,为大家介绍五个支持Python的2D、3D游戏开发库。
1、Cocos2d:是一系列开源软件框架,用于构建跨平台2D游戏和应用程序,由cocos2d-x、cocos2d-js、cocos2d-xna和cocos2d多种框架组成,像大鱼赌场、城堡冲突等小游戏,就是用此框架开发出来的。
2、Panda3D:是由迪士尼开发的3D游戏引擎,一个用于Python和C++程序的3D渲染和游戏开发框架,并由卡内基梅陇娱乐技术中心负责维护,使用C++编写的,针对Python进行了完全的封装。
3、Pygame:它是一组Python模块,用来编写游戏,可支持Python3.7,游戏例子有:纸牌游戏、超级马里奥、击球等多种游戏。
4、Pyogre:ogre 3D渲染引擎的Python绑定,可以用来开发游戏和仿真程序等任何3D应用,它的API更加稳定,也非常快速灵活。
5、RenPy:一个视觉小说引擎,被世界各地的成千万的创造者所使用,它可以帮助你使用文字、图像和声音来讲述电脑和移动设备上的故事。RenPy是开放源码的,可免费的商业用途,易于学习的脚本语言任何人都能有效地编写大型视觉小说,它的Python脚本足以用来模拟游戏。

‘伍’ Python怎么制作一个完整的斗地主望回答。

可以告诉你,但是价格得按万起步。

‘陆’ 用python做斗地主,大家都有什么好一点的设计方案呢越详细越好,拜托了

如果只是自己练习着玩。你随便写一写吧。 如果是想做成一个真正的游戏。一个产品。就首先理清楚需求。

你这个软件谁用的。怎么赚钱,要满足用户的哪些需求。再根据这些需求建立一个开发方案。

我只能猜猜,你这个软件是局域内学生用,联网玩的。因为你们不能上互联网。所以只能局域网玩。我记得微软的几个牌类游戏是可以联网玩的。你自己检查一下看。开源的也有类似的程序。

如果一定要自己写这就需要分客户端与服务端。服务端可以不用开发。这种简单游戏,直接用一个数据库当服务端好了。或者是一个memcache或者是一个key value的非关系型数据库。总之不用认证,不用加密

下面就是客户端开发。网络部分不说。那就只剩下界面与扑克的算法。界面也不用说什么,做一个Canvas,然后绘制,这样效果最好,但是复杂了。直接用一个Image控件来玩,相对非常简单。动态创建与删除控件。绑定控件的消息就成了。

至于扑克算法及数据结构。这个好象没有太多难度。会打牌的人都可以做。记录打牌的所有牌的状态,每个玩家的状态,以及按次序发牌,判断胜负就可以了。

‘柒’ python培训入门教程怎样入门呢

送你一份学习python的路线图
一、Python的普及入门
1.1 Python入门学习须知和书本配套学习建议
1.2 Python简史
1.3 Python的市场需求及职业规划
1.4 Python学习是选择2.0还是3.0?
二、Python的学习环境安装
1.在Windows安装Python的教程
2.在Linux上安装python
3.搭建Python 多版本共存管理工具 Pyenv
4.Python开发环境配置
三、开启你的Python之路
1.Python 世界的开端: hello world
2.Python 世界的开端:四则运算
3.Python流程控制语句深度解读
4.Python循环
四、Python中级进阶
1.Python数据类型详解
2.Python列表及元组详解
3.Python字符串操作深度解析
4.Python函数式编程指南:函数
5.Python函数式编程指南:迭代器
6.Python函数式编程指南:生成器
7.Python装饰器详解
五、Python高级技巧
1.装饰器深度解析
2.深入 Python 字典
3.Python线程技术
4.Python 的异步 IO:Asyncio 简介
5.Python实现线程安全队列
六、Python常用工具
1.2017最受欢迎的 15 大 Python 库
2.5个高效Python库
3.Django 官方教程
4.Python Django的正确学习方法
5.Python自然语言处理工具小结
6.数据科学常用Python 工具
七、Python实战练习
1.Python破解斗地主残局
2.python实现爬虫功能
4.使用Python – PCA分析进行金融数据分析
5.用python制作游戏外挂吗?
6.运用爬虫抓取网易云音乐评论生成词云
7.使用Scrapy爬起点网的完本小说
8.TensorFlow计算加速
八、其他
1.选择学习编程,为什么一定首推Python?
2.为什么 Python 这么火?
3.Python如何快速入门?
4.Python入门之学习资料推荐
5.Python必备的19 个编程资源
6.Python入门知识点总结
7.Python学不好怎么办?
8.Python学习有哪些阶段?
9.参加Python培训会有前景吗?
10.Python培训班真的有效吗?
11.参加Python培训前应该做哪些准备?
12.11道Python基本面试题|深入解答
13.Python求职怎么拿到Offer

‘捌’ Python开发过哪些知名网站和游戏

谷歌:Google App Engine、http://code.Google.com、Google earth、谷歌爬虫、Google广告等项目都在大量使用Python开发
CIA:美国中情局网站就是用Python开发的
NASA:美国航天局(NASA)大量使用Python进行数据分析和运算。美国宇航局从1994年起把python作为主要开发语言。
YouTube:世界上最大的视频网站YouTube就是Python开发的
Dropbox:美国最大的在线云存储网站,全部用Python实现,每天网站处理10亿个文件的上传和下载。
Instagram:美国最大的图片分享社交网站,每天超过3千万张照片被分享,全部用Python开发
Facebook:大量的基础库均通过Python实现的
Redhat:世界上最流行的Linux发新版本中的yum包管理工具就是用Python开发的
豆瓣:公司几乎所有的业务均是通过Python开发的
知乎:国内最大的问答社区,通过Python开发(Quora)
春雨医生:国内知名的在线医疗网站是用Python开发的
除上面之外,还有搜狐、金山、腾讯、盛大、网易、网络、阿里、淘宝、薯仔、新浪、果壳等公司都在使用Python完成各种各样的任务。

阅读全文

与python斗地主真实案例相关的资料

热点内容
flash命令行 浏览:666
反诈骗app怎么找回密码 浏览:631
java方法和函数 浏览:420
程序员衣服穿反 浏览:959
java多类继承 浏览:159
怎么用多玩我的世界连接服务器地址 浏览:483
为什么华为手机比安卓流畅 浏览:177
javamap多线程 浏览:228
卡西欧app怎么改时间 浏览:843
jquery压缩图片 浏览:970
用纸筒做解压东西 浏览:238
神奇宝贝服务器如何tp 浏览:244
云服务器支持退货吗 浏览:277
贷款等额本息算法 浏览:190
根服务器地址配置 浏览:501
单片机是软件还是硬件 浏览:624
vivo手机怎么看编译编号 浏览:320
塑钢扣条算法 浏览:301
linux应用程序安装 浏览:414
linux怎么查找命令 浏览:431